Home > CRM, Javista, Microsoft, Microsoft Dynamics > Microsoft Dynamics CRM: Designing Survey Applications

Microsoft Dynamics CRM: Designing Survey Applications

I have seen many people talking about designing survey applications in Dynamics CRM. I have analyzed some different approaches to survey application design and their integration with Dynamics CRM 4.0.

Using WSS/MOSS 2007

WSS 3.0/MOSS 2007 provides a very comprehensive tool for planning, designing. Executing and analysing surveys. Following feature are provided out of the box in WSS/MOSS:

• Planning/Designing Survey
• Branching Survey
• Various Question Types
• Comprehensive analysis tool
• Executing survey







  1. Out of the box tools for Designing, Distributing, Executing and Analysis
  2. WSS 3.0 is Free so no Licensing Cost
  3. No Development Cost as its out of the box


  1. Data will be saved outside CRM
  2. Unavailability in offline client

WSS/MOSS survey can be integrated with MSCRM using IFRAME. This is a loose integration and data will be saved and presented in WSS/MOSS and not in CRM.

Using InfoPath

Survey can be designed in InfoPath/Windows Form Server. InfoPath forms can be transmitted and rendered in IE. InfoPath Forms can collect information and save the survey response. This is also not ideal solution as data is saved in InfoPath forms and a comprehensive analysis tool needs to be developed.



  1. Surveys can be designed in InfoPath
  2. Can be distributed using Online or by sending emails


  1. InfoPath required for Email Surveys
  2. Analysis tool needs to be developed for Response analysis and reporting

Custom Solution in CRM (xRM)

Custom solution can be developed with enough development effort. In this solution, survey is planned/designed and analyzed in MSCRM but executed using Custom web application. This custom web application will be integrated in CRM or rendered online to execute Survey and collect survey response.

This solution provides access to survey data using web client, outlook online and outlook offline.



  1. Available web, online and offline clients
  2. Fully supported and upgradable
  3. Executed through Custom Web application
  4. Survey Data and Response will be saved in Dynamics CRM


  1. Considerable development effort is required
  2. License is required in order to expose CRM data to non users

Please comment or send your suggestions/issues at ayaz.ahmad at hotmail dot com.


Ayaz Ahmad

  1. No comments yet.
  1. No trackbacks yet.

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s

%d bloggers like this: